Part ROM RAM* Speed I/O Package Number (KB) (Bytes) (MHz) (18-Pin) Z86317 2 124 4 13 DIP, SOIC Z86317 CMOS Z8® 8-BIT MICROCONTROLLER n P24-P27 Can be Configured as a Voltage Divider During Input Mode n On-Chip Precision RC Oscillator (Tolerance = ± 10%) n Fast Instruction Pointer: 1.5 µs @ 4 MHz n ESD Protection Circuitry n Hardwired Watch-Dog Timer (WDT) GENERAL DESCRIPTION The Z86317 device provides two on-chip 8-bit program- mable counter/timers with a large number of user-select- able modes. Each counter/timer is driven by its own 6-bit programmable prescaler. The Z86317 counter/timers offload system real-time tasks such as counting/timing and input/output data communications for increased sys- tem efficiency. Notes: All Signals with a preceding front slash, "/", are active Low, e.g.; B//W (WORD is active Low); /B/W (BYTE is active Low, only). Power connections follow conventional descriptions below: Connection Circuit Device Power V CC VDD Ground GND V SS The Z86317 is a member of the Z8 ® family of CMOS microcontrollers architected to be used in mouse applica- tions. These devices offer on-board pull-up and pull-down resistors, a scalable trip-point buffer to accommodate opto-transistor outputs, and high drive ports capable of up to 10 mA current sinking per pin (six pins maximum). A permanently enabled Watch-Dog Timer ensures opera- tional reliability across a broad range of mouse application environments. The precision RC oscillator filters out high- frequency noise from the oscillator input pin. When config- ured as inputs, P24-P27 are configured as voltage divider (25K pull-up / 7.5K pull-down). The input levels are ad- justed for connection to the emitters of the opto-transistors and switch at a voltage level of 0.4 V DD. For applications requiring powerful I/O capabilities, the Z86317 provides dedicated input and output lines that are grouped into three ports. VLV VCC Low Voltage Protection 2.5 3 2.7 V @ 2 MHz Max VTP Trip Point Voltage 5.5V 1.9 2.5 2.2 V P24-P27 4.5V 1.5 2.1 1.8 V IIL Input Leakage 5.5V –1.0 1.0 0.4 µAV IN = OV, VCC IOL Output Leakage 5.5V –1.0 1.0 0.4 µAV IN = OV, VCC IDD Supply Current 5.5V 3.0 1.44 mA All Output and I/O Pins Floating @ 1 MHz 5.5V 4.0 2.60 mA All Output and I/O Pins Floating @ 2 MHz 5.5V 6.0 4.28 mA All Output and I/O Pins Floating @ 4 MHz IDD1 Standby Current 5.5V 1.3 0.70 mA HALT mode V IN = 0V, VCC @ 1 MHz 5.5V 1.5 0.80 mA HALT mode V IN = 0V, VCC @ 2 MHz 5.5V 2.0 1.0 mA HALT mode V IN = 0V, VCC @ 4 MHz IPU Pull-Up Current 4.5V –20 µAV IH @ 3V P00-02 5.5 –85 µAV IH @ 4V P31, P33 IPD Pull-Down Current 4.5V +20 µAV IL @ 1V P00-02 5.5 +95 µAV IL @ 1V P31, P33 IPU Pull-Up Current 4.5V –450 µAV IL = 0V P20, P22 5.5 –85 µAV IL = 0V Notes: The device is functional to VLV voltage. The minimum operational VDD is determined by the value of the VLV voltage at ambient temperature. The VLV voltage increases as the temperature decreases.
